Phillipa started machine knitting about 3 years ago as a hobby, something different from her jewellery line. Phillipa quickly got a little obsessed with it! And found it so much fun to see a garment take shape, and was able to use her love of yarn and colour in the design and construction.

These scarves and wraps are knitted on her 1970's Brother 830 which has a ribber; this is a completely manual machine. Initially the yarn she used came from wherever she could find it, as she needed it to be on a cone, soft, a nice colour, and plenty of it. She now have a couple of sources of yarns that use Merino, Mohair, Cashmere, Silk and Angora that she uses.

Her priority is softness.

The first colour on the label is the base colour, and this is used throughout the whole scarf/wrap. Then the other colours are changed at regular intervals to create the horizontal check effect. The vertical strips will always be the base yarn, and it is also predominant on the back. the scarves and wraps are reversible and can be worn with either side facing out. On the label she has only written the main percentage of that fibre. The rest of the yarn will be Merino or a man made fibre to give it strength.
